Valentine’s Day Lake Erie North Shore 2026: Romantic Events & Luxury Stays

Discover the most romantic ways to celebrate Valentine’s Day 2026 in the Lake Erie North Shore region this year. From the sleepy snow covered vineyards of Essex to the charming streets of Kingsville, local businesses are offering curated experiences to make the weekend, truly special.

Romantic Fine Dining & Wine Pairings

Indulge in the region’s best culinary offerings with curated multi-course menus and expert wine pairings designed for an intimate night out in the heart of wine country. Be sure to call ahead to reserve your spot as these offerings are sure to sell-out!

Viewpointe Estate Winery (Essex): Celebrate with a $150 per couple dinner on February 14 at 7 PM. The ticket includes a shared appetizer, two individual mains, and a shared dessert, featuring entrees like blackened cajun beef medallions or cornmeal-crusted Lake Erie pickerel.

Paglione Estate Winery (Harrow/Essex): Offering two seatings at 5 PM and 8 PM on Saturday This candlelit dinner experience costs $105 per guest (gratuity included) and includes 3 oz pours of boutique wines with each course. Guests can enjoy their handcrafted wines along side your choice of Cab Sauv braised beef short ribs or parmesan crusted halibut or forest blend mushroom pot pie as an entree. Pro tip: Reservations required by Feb 9th

Kingscoast Estate Winery (Kingsville): Offering two Prix Fixe options for Saturday evening. Option A is a four course option at $80 per guest features beef filet or chicken supreme as an entree or you can opt for the five course Option B at $100 per guest includes 12oz ribeye steak or Caribbean-style black cod or cabernet sauvignon braised lamb shank. A choice of grilled portobello steak is also being offered vegetarian entree with each menu.

O Sarracino: Their special Valentine’s menu offers three courses with the option to add dessert and includes high-end options such as 40-day aged AAA Beef Tenderloin Medallions, Vesuvio al Rosato con Aragosta e Gamberi – a pasta dish with lobster and shrimp and AlmondCrusted Chicken alAmaretto ranging from $70 -80 per guest.

Colchester Ridge Estate Winery (Essex): For music lover’s, CREW is accepting reservations for their Valentine’s Weekend Menu from 5 PM to 8 PM on both Friday and Saturday accompanied with live music by local talent Sam Bourque and Emily Staley.

Cooper’s Hawk Vineyards (Harrow/Essex): Invites guests to their Valentine’s at The Vines event on both Friday and Saturday evening. Their 3 course menu offers delicious choices in each course along with a coursed wine pairing at $100 per guest, plus gratuity. Entree options include 8 oz Peppercorn New York Steak, Red Wine Braised Lamb, Scallop Risotto, or Pesto Gnocchi.

The Butcher of Kingsville: For an intimate evening try their curated Valentine’s Dinner for Two. This elevated kit features everything you need for a five-star meal: comforting roasted red pepper and tomato soup, mini sourdough from Sour & Salt, and decadent potato dauphinoise. The centerpiece is your choice of two grass-fed, dry-aged ribeyes or filet mignons, complete with house-made demi-glace, compound butters bursting with flavour, and Maldon finishing salt. Pro Tip: Be sure to ask about their Charcuterie for Two package—it’s the perfect spread to enjoy by the fireplace before dinner is served.

Creative & Wellness Experiences

Move beyond the traditional dinner date with interactive activities that promote connection, creativity, and restorative relaxation.

Paint Your Partner Workshop (Cooper’s Hawk Vineyards): This “romantic-meets-playful” session starts at 2 PM on Valentine’s Day. For $90 plus tax, couples receive supplies, a charcuterie snack box for two, and sparkling wine samples to fuel their artistic inspiration.

Partner Stretch & Massage (Estate of Health, Kingsville): Running from 5 PM to 6:30 PM, this $60 per couple class teaches simple massage techniques and partner stretches. The session includes their signature Warming Massage oil blend and a mini bottle to take home.

Winter Restore Retreat (Estate of Health): For an early celebration, this one-day retreat on February 7, 2026, focuses on finding cozy comfort during the midwinter season.

Unique Gifts & Sweet Gestures

Surprise your loved ones with thoughtful, locally sourced gifts that give back to the community or offer a personalized touch.

Smuccie-Grams (Mucci Farms): These charitable grams support the Ronald McDonald House Southwestern Ontario. Orders must be placed by February 1st, with pickup scheduled for February 12th or 13th at the Mucci Farms Kingsville location.

Custom Wine Labels (Cooper’s Hawk Vineyards): Personalize a bottle of wine with a “Love the Wine You’re With” label for $21.50. These can be paired with Dutch Boys chocolate and wine charms for a complete gift set.
